A Closed Composite Right-/Left-Handed Transmission Line Based on Substrate Integrated Waveguide Technology

摘要

The specialities of a composite right-/left-handed (CRLH) transmission line (TL) are realised in a closed structure with the purpose to utilise its particular phase behaviour while it transports energy with low attenuation. The configuration is derived from the H_(10) rectangular hollow waveguide mode concluding in a reproducible and verifiable design, even of the so-called balanced state. Its origin implies inherent shielding and fundamental mode operation as crucial advantages in comparison to many other designs. The dispersion behaviour is validated on two ways and the Bloch impedance is computed and evaluated with respect to matching. The fabricated prototype is light-weight and compact. The simulation results demonstrate low attenuation and they are confirmed by measurements.
机译:复合右手/左手(CRLH)传输线(TL)的特殊性是在封闭结构中实现的,目的是在传输能量时以低衰减的方式利用其特定的相位特性。该构型是从H_(10)矩形中空波导模式得出的,该模式即使是所谓的平衡状态,也具有可重现和可验证的设计。与许多其他设计相比,其起源意味着固有的屏蔽和基本模式操作是至关重要的优势。可以通过两种方法来验证色散行为,并针对匹配来计算和评估Bloch阻抗。制作的原型轻巧紧凑。仿真结果证明了低衰减,并通过测量得到了证实。
